1 vae qui descendunt in Aegyptum ad auxilium in equis sperantes et habentes fiduciam super quadrigis quia multae sunt et super equitibus quia praevalidi nimis et non sunt confisi super Sanctum Israhel et Dominum non requisierunt
Woe to those that go down to Egypt for help; and depend for support on horses, and trust on chariots, because they are many; and on horsemen, because they are very strong; but who turn not unto the Holy One of Israel, and seek not the Lord!
2 ipse autem sapiens adduxit malum et verba sua non abstulit et consurget contra domum pessimorum et contra auxilium operantium iniquitatem
Yet he also is wise, and bringeth evil, and taketh not back his words; and riseth up against the house of evil-doers, and against the help of those that work injustice.
3 Aegyptus homo et non deus et equi eorum caro et non spiritus et Dominus inclinabit manum suam et corruet auxiliator et cadet cui praestatur auxilium simulque omnes consumentur
But the Egyptians are men, and not God; and their horses are flesh, and not spirit; and the Lord will stretch out his hand, and there shall stumble the helper, and he that is helped shall fall down, and they all shall perish together.
4 quia haec dicit Dominus ad me quomodo si rugiat leo et catulus leonis super praedam suam cum occurrerit ei multitudo pastorum a voce eorum non formidabit et a multitudine eorum non pavebit sic descendet Dominus exercituum ut proelietur super montem Sion et super collem eius
For thus hath said the Lord unto me, Just as the lion or the young lion growleth over his prey, against whom is called forth the company of shepherds, of whose voice he is not afraid, and is not depressed because of their multitude: thus will the Lord come down, to fight on mount Zion and on its hill.
5 sicut aves volantes sic proteget Dominus exercituum Hierusalem protegens et liberans transiens et salvans
As fluttering birds, so will the Lord of hosts shield Jerusalem; shielding and delivering; sparing and preserving.
6 convertimini sicut in profundum recesseratis filii Israhel
Turn ye unto him from whom the children of Israel have deeply revolted.
7 in die enim illa abiciet vir idola argenti sui et idola auri sui quae fecerunt vobis manus vestrae in peccatum
For on that day shall every man despise his idols of silver, and his idols of gold, which your own hands have made unto you for a sin.
8 et cadet Assur in gladio non viri et gladius non hominis vorabit eum et fugiet non a facie gladii et iuvenes eius vectigales erunt
Then shall Asshur fall by the sword of one who is not a man; and the sword of one who is not a son of earth shall devour him; and he shall flee him from the sword, and his young men shall become tributary.
9 et fortitudo eius a terrore transibit et pavebunt fugientes principes eius dixit Dominus cuius ignis est in Sion et caminus eius in Hierusalem
And his stronghold shall pass away for fear, and his princes shall be terrified because of the ensign, saith the Lord, who hath a fire in Zion, and a furnace in Jerusalem.
